Job overview
Proficient or Experienced Science teacher required to teach Stage 3, 4 and 5 Science Curriculum. The successful applicant will be required to teach Science to Year 6 students. Experience in teaching STEM would be highly advantageous.
GENERAL SELECTION CRITERIA FOR TEACHING POSITIONS
The successful applicant will:
- have demonstrated experience in responding to contemporary research, trends and initiatives that support the implementation of educational best practice within their subject area
- provide high quality teaching and learning programs and activities that are context relevant, promote independent learning and integrate relevant technologies
- possess well developed interpersonal skills
- participate in the Co-Curricular life of the College
- be committed to ongoing professional learning
- support the Jewish Zionist ethos of the College
All appointments will be based on merit selection. Any offer of employment will be subject to background checks and child protection screening.
